Transaction 31a57cf10379111b8a3121a3237dd2e54bfed14589abf43eccf1e3c87d40d639
1 Input
2 Outputs
- 31a57cf10379111b8a3121a3237dd2e54bfed14589abf43eccf1e3c87d40d639:0
- 31a57cf10379111b8a3121a3237dd2e54bfed14589abf43eccf1e3c87d40d639:1
value 924515
address 35BbReM6avw4TeiUQjeBzaVDRoT2QVoEB5
value 1165366
address 1AbMKdUmcWtNFDFNBNWAznNyRNxwyLYA8X